Florida Grand Opera Sets 72nd Gala for 11/17

Florida Grand Opera will celebrate the start of the 72nd opera season with its annual gala - "An Evening at the Cafe Momus". Held at the Adrienne Arsht Center for the Performing Arts of Miami-Dade County, this glamorous themed evening will follow the opening night performance of Puccini's La boheme on November 17, 2012, featuring opera stars Ailyn Perez and Arturo Chacon-Cruz.

JESUS CHRIST SUPERSTAR Resurrects The Count de Hoernle Theatre (The Caldwell) In Boca

In an effort to get the theatre's footlights shining again, two sister theatre companies - Entr'Acte Theatrix and Palm Beach Principal Players - are co-producing JESUS CHRIST SUPERSTAR, which will run for 10 performances at the former Caldwell Theatre, July 5-15. The dynamic rock musical by Andrew Lloyd Webber and Tim Rice is a musical interpretation of the final days of Jesus Christ that is not so much a story about religion as it is about the emergence of a charismatic rebel who surfaces among an oppressed people to pacifistically challenge the moral state of existing affairs - all told in the musical vernacular of rock 'n' roll, just like HAIR before it.

The ARSHT Center Announces New Season Of THEATER UP CLOSE

Now celebrating its seventh season, the Adrienne Arsht Center for the Performing Arts of Miami-Dade County announced an extraordinary lineup of new and ongoing partnerships for the THEATER UP CLOSE 2012-2013 SEASON. This season features six incredible productions - such as the world premiere of Girls vs. Boys, a new rock musical; two Florida premieres including All New People and The Nutcracker; and a Miami premiere with The Savannah Disputation - from stellar local and national art organizations, all in the intimate Carnival Studio Theater in the Sanford and Dolores Ziff Ballet Opera House.

DISNEY'S THE LION KING Leaps To Miami's Arsht Center - Now Playing

In its 15th year, THE LION KING remains ascendant, recently becoming the highest-grossing Broadway show in history. Since its Broadway premiere on November 13, 1997, 19 productions around the globe have been seen by more than 64 million people, grossed over $4.8 billion and, cumulatively, run a staggering 91 years. Produced by Disney Theatrical Productions (under the direction of Thomas Schumacher), THE LION KING is the sixth longest running musical in Broadway history and only the second show to produce five productions running 10 or more years.
